PLANT CITY, FL — A 20-year-old Plant City man was arrested earlier this month and charged with threatening to kill the president of the United States, the U.S. Department of Justice said in a news release.

Nick Guadalupe Cruz-Lopez faces up to five years in federal prison if convicted.

He posted a photo of himself in a vehicle holding an AR-15-style rifle with the words, “MAGA Otw to kill trump” (sic) to his Instagram account on April 2, the department said.

Federal agents found Cruz-Lopez that day and arrested him.
